1989 Ford Escort vs. 2001 Opel Astra
To start off, 2001 Opel Astra is newer by 12 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Ford Escort.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Ford Escort would be higher. At 1,700 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Ford Escort is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2001 Opel Astra (88 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 29 more horse power than 1989 Ford Escort. (59 HP @ 4800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2001 Opel Astra should accelerate faster than 1989 Ford Escort.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2001 Opel Astra (127 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 18 more torque (in Nm) than 1989 Ford Escort. (109 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 2001 Opel Astra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1989 Ford Escort.
Compare all specifications:
1989 Ford Escort | 2001 Opel Astra | |
Make | Ford | Opel |
Model | Escort | Astra |
Year Released | 1989 | 2001 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1700 cc | 1389 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 59 HP | 88 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 109 Nm | 127 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2500 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 10.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Length | 4030 mm | 4300 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1650 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 2620 mm |
